These amounts are all inclusive: equipped desk, charges, cleaning and shared services. That is what makes them hard to compare with a conventional lease, always quoted excluding charges.
Per desk, half of the Porth spaces renting closed offices come in below £189 excl. tax per month.
This is the figure we use to compare two buildings: it cancels out office size and brings out the real gap between operators.

A serviced contract bundles service charges, utilities, cleaning, mail handling, and high-speed Wi-Fi into one predictable monthly invoice. Signing a traditional lease instead lands you with multi-year liability, upfront fit-out capital, and dilapidation claims when you leave.
